WebBoth reactions give 100% enolization due to the use of very strong non-equilibrium bases. However, the reaction with sodium hydride (NaH) gives a more thermodynamically stable enolate. Unlike LDA, hydride anion is very small so it can easily reach a more sterically hindered proton and give a thermodynamic enolate.

Alkynyl Grignards are unique among Grignards for their ability to do SN2 chemistry. (All other Grignards are too basic / too reactive, and may just give you an E2 product).

WebFor this reason, they used LDA as the lithiating agent, which led to the formation of two regioisomeric ArLi species. The ability to track the interconversion of these two isomers via ReactIR enabled the identification of the optimum set of reaction variables to ensure the formation of the thermodynamically preferred 3-Li species.
